Vontier is a public company headquartered in Raleigh, North Carolina, with 5,001–10,000 employees and operations across 18 countries. The business spans five verticals: convenience retail, mobility infrastructure, retail and commercial fueling, fleet management, and vehicle maintenance and repair. Operationally, the company manages complex supplier networks, compliance frameworks (SOX, OSHA), and distributed field service execution. Active projects center on preventive maintenance planning, new product commercialization, supplier performance monitoring, and process automation—all areas where legacy systems (SAP, Hyperion) intersect with newer cloud and agile adoption.
